当前位置: 首页 > news >正文

淄博网站建设给力臻动传媒怎么简单攻击一个网站

淄博网站建设给力臻动传媒,怎么简单攻击一个网站,wordpress oss压缩,网站开发的成品删除重复元素 题目://给你一个 非严格递增排列 的数组 nums ,请你 原地 删除重复出现的元素,使每个元素 只出现一次 ,返回删除后数组的新长度。元素的 相对顺序 应该保持 一致 。然后返回 nums 中唯一元素的个数 思路&#xff1a…
删除重复元素

题目://给你一个 非严格递增排列 的数组 nums ,请你 原地 删除重复出现的元素,使每个元素 只出现一次 ,返回删除后数组的新长度。元素的 相对顺序 应该保持 一致 。然后返回 nums 中唯一元素的个数
思路:
快指针遍历数组
慢指针记录保留的

int removedup(vector<int>& nums){int len = nums.size();int fast =1;//快指针遍历数组int slow =1; //慢指针记录保留的if(len ==0){//参数校验return 0;}while(fast < len){if(nums[fast] != nums[fast-1]){nums[slow]=nums[fast];slow++;}fast++;}return slow;
}
反转链表

1、先用c记录b一会的位置,
2、然后b指向a节点
3、然后ab后往后移动一个,
循环此过程
在这里插入图片描述

/翻转链表(迭代版本) 
struct ListNode{int val;ListNode *next;ListNode(int x): val(x),next(NULL){}
};
ListNode* ReverseList(ListNode* head){if(!head || !head->next) return head; //只有一个结点或者节点为空auto a = head;//自动匹配类型auto b = head->next;while(b){auto c = b->next;//记录一下b一会的位置b->next = a;a = b;b = c;}head->next = NULL;return a; 
}///反转链表和上面一样效果
class Solution {
public:ListNode* reverseList(ListNode* head) {ListNode* prev = nullptr;while (head) {ListNode* next = head->next;head->next = prev;prev = head;head = next;}return prev;}
};
http://www.yayakq.cn/news/273637/

相关文章:

  • 手机网站 生成app四川可以做宣传的网站
  • 东莞做网站的联系电话办网站怎么赚钱
  • 网站做配置文件的作用网址导航网址大全
  • 汉阴做网站网站里图片做超链接
  • wordpress整站源码带数据做一个网站需要什么条件
  • 网站备案要到哪里下载超级外链发布工具
  • 哪些网站是用iframe天津建设工程信息网专家
  • 适合个人做的网站有哪些东西吗网页制作素材包
  • 建筑工程网教惠州seo外包公司
  • 做网站系统校园视频网站建设
  • 中国做网站的公司排名网站做哪些比较赚钱
  • 网站开发需要什么工程师企业邮箱申请免费
  • 如何创建微网站思源黑体可以做网站
  • 采集网站会员东莞樟木头做网站哪家好
  • 哪些网站做推广软件工程开发师
  • 布吉做棋牌网站建设哪家服务好网站开发与设计教程
  • 论坛型网站怎么做的wordpress用什么框架开发
  • 成都可以做网站的公司销售网络建设应该如何着手
  • 建网站用什么程序好网站ip流量查询
  • 一图读懂制作网站公司logo在线设计
  • 国外装修效果图网站新乡网站建设哪家好
  • 宁波网络营销网站建设海南网警网上报警平台
  • 新闻客户端网站开发photoshop怎么修改图片文字
  • 网站建设怎么评估艺点意创设计公司
  • 站长推荐自动跳转导航入口wordpress 防盗链
  • 怎么帮人做网站施工企业主要负责人对安全生产的
  • 360免费建站视频永久免费win云服务器
  • 设计网站推荐什么主题网页设计与制作课程的建设历程
  • 软件开发商网站网站建设论文选题
  • 上海做企业网站pptai一键生成免费